Population Overview

Big River is a small community located in California, within San Bernardino County. The total population is 1,140. It ranks as the 1027th most populous out of 1,570 Census-designated places in California.

Age Demographics

The median age in Big River is 59.5 years. This is 57% higher than the state median of 37.9 years. Only 8.9% of residents are under 18, indicating fewer families with children. 16.3% of residents are 75 or older, suggesting a significant retirement-age population with implications for healthcare services and senior housing.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Big River is $39,773. This is 60% lower than the state median of $99,122. It is also 51% lower than the national median of $80,734. The poverty rate stands at 20.0%. This is 67% higher than the state poverty rate of 12.0%. The unemployment rate is 11.3%. This is 70% higher than the state rate of 6.6%. The median home value is $126,200. Housing costs are 83% lower than the state median of $734,700. The home-value-to-income ratio is 3.2x. 79.5%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 42% higher than the state average of 55.9%.

Race & Ethnicity

The largest racial or ethnic group in Big River is White (non-Hispanic), making up 80.2% of the population.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 15.8%. The White (non-Hispanic) population is significantly higher than the state average (80.2% vs 33.8%). The Hispanic or Latino population (15.8%) is well below the state average of 40.2%.

Education

10.6%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 71% lower than the state rate of 37.1%. Nationally, 35.7%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 86.3%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Big River, California is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 2020–2024 5-Year Estimates. The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ually and pools five years of responses so that even small communities can be measured, though the margin of error widens as the population falls. Comparisons are made against California state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 1,570 Census-designated places in California.
